Exploring Cognitive Maps Through Sketching, Melissa M. Nantais
Exploring Cognitive Maps Through Sketching, Melissa M. Nantais
Electronic Thesis and Dissertation Repository
Abstract
Periodic testing has been found to improve the accuracy of participants’ cognitive maps when an onscreen map is provided, however, it is unclear whether the same results would occur without the onscreen map. The current study investigated whether drawing a map periodically while exploring the virtual environment Silcton would improve cognitive map accuracy. Participants explored Silcton and were stopped every 4 minutes to either sketch a map of Silcton, identify items seen in Silcton, or colour an unrelated picture, and a baseline group was not stopped. Investigating The Role Of Atrx In Glutamatergic Hippocampal Neurons, Renee Tamming
Investigating The Role Of Atrx In Glutamatergic Hippocampal Neurons, Renee Tamming
Electronic Thesis and Dissertation Repository
Mutations in ATRX, a Snf2-type chromatin remodeler, frequently lead to intellectual disability. However, the function of ATRX within the brain in cognition and synaptic transmission are incompletely understood. The aim of this study was to investigate the role of ATRX in the adult mouse brain. While complete loss of ATRX in the embryonic mouse brain results in perinatal lethality, mosaic expression of ATRX stunted growth and perturbed circulating IGF-1 levels. Effect Of Atrx Inactivation On Hippocampal Synaptic Plasticity In Mice, Radu Gugustea
Effect Of Atrx Inactivation On Hippocampal Synaptic Plasticity In Mice, Radu Gugustea
Electronic Thesis and Dissertation Repository
The ATRX gene encodes an ATP-dependent chromatin remodeling factor and gene mutations cause developmental defects and intellectual disability. Conditional ablation of Atrx in mouse postnatal forebrain excitatory neurons (ATRX-KO) leads to spatial learning and memory impairments. Thus, we hypothesized that hippocampal synaptic transmission and plasticity are disrupted in ATRX-KO mice. Long-term potentiation (LTP), a cellular correlate of memory, and input-output relation of paired-pulse responses were studied in urethane-anesthetized mice in vivo. The Role Of H3k4 Methyltransferases In Drosophila Memory, Nicholas Raun
The Role Of H3k4 Methyltransferases In Drosophila Memory, Nicholas Raun
Electronic Thesis and Dissertation Repository
Gene transcription required for long-term memory requires the modification of histones. However, there are still many uncertainties about the identity and spatial expression of genes regulated by histone modifications during memory related processes. In this project I examined the role of Drosophila melanogaster methyltransferases Set1 and trx in courtship memory. Genetic knockdown of Set1 and trx in the mushroom body (MB) revealed that Set1 was necessary for short- and long-term memory, while trx was only required for long-term memory.
